Windows Server 2003-Computer bleibt beim Neustart hängen

Windows Server 2003-Computer bleibt beim Neustart hängen

Ich habe einen Win 2K3-Server, der in einem Rechenzentrum gehostet wird, daher erfolgt die gesamte Verwaltung über RDP.

Die letzten paar Male, als ich es nach dem Patchen neu gestartet habe, blieb der Server hängen – anscheinend ist er auf dem Weg nach unten, da IIS und SQL noch öffentlich reagieren, aber mein Zugriff auf RDP geht sofort weg. Der Server wird auf unbestimmte Zeit in diesem Zustand bleiben und ich muss einen Rechenzentrumstechniker bitten, einen Kaltstart durchzuführen, da sie auch lokal keinen Konsolenzugriff darauf haben.

In den Ereignisprotokollen steht lediglich, dass mein Neustart fehlgeschlagen ist, und ein weiterer Protokolleintrag lässt darauf schließen, dass ein Anwendungs-Popup mit der Warnung erschienen ist, dass die Maschine nicht verfügbar wäre, bis sie lokal gestartet würde?

Was könnte die Ursache sein? Ich weiß, dass Apps von Drittanbietern manchmal nicht gut mit dem Befehl zum Herunterfahren funktionieren, aber in den Protokollen gibt es keinen Hinweis darauf, welche App das Problem ist, und der Rat aus der MS-Wissensdatenbank lautet, Apps einzeln zu entfernen und jedes Mal neu zu starten, bis das Problem behoben ist! Dies ist ein Live-Server, daher habe ich diesen Luxus nicht.

Gibt es irgendwelche Einstellungen, die ich mir ansehen könnte und die möglicherweise die Popup-Nachricht ausgelöst haben, und hat jemand gute Vorschläge, um die zugrunde liegende Ursache zu finden, ohne dass ich den MS-Ansatz anwenden muss, um Apps wahllos per Pull-Entfernung zu entfernen?

Protokolleinträge:

22:15:20 – ID 1074 – Der Prozess Explorer.exe hat das Herunterfahren des Computers eingeleitet … aus folgendem Grund: Sonstiges (geplant)

22:15:20 - ID 26 - Anwendungs-Popup: Windows: Wenn Sie diesen Remotecomputer herunterfahren, kann ihn niemand mehr verwenden, bis ihn jemand am Remotestandort manuell neu startet? Möchten Sie mit dem Herunterfahren fortfahren?

22:15:22 - ID 1073 - Der Versuch des BenutzersNutzernameComputer neu starten/herunterfahrenServerfehlgeschlagen

22:15:41 – ID 1074 – Der Prozess Explorer.exe hat das Herunterfahren des Computers eingeleitet … aus folgendem Grund: Sonstiges (geplant)

22:15:45 - ID 1074 - Der Prozess svchost.exe hat das Herunterfahren des Computers eingeleitet... aus folgendem Grund: Es konnte kein Titel oder Grund gefunden werden

Antwort1

Ist jemand interaktiv angemeldet, z. B. über VNC oder eine automatische Anmeldung? Ich habe das gelegentlich gesehen, wenn etwas in der interaktiven Sitzung hängt. Normalerweise passiert das, nachdem die VNC- und TS-Server heruntergefahren wurden, sodass es keine Möglichkeit gibt, sich einzuloggen und den Server zu kicken! Heutzutage bestehe ich darauf, dass alle meine Server eine DRAC-Karte haben (bei einem HP verwende ich die iLO-Karte), sodass ich sie notfalls per Fernzugriff zurücksetzen kann.

JR

Hilft das:

http://support.microsoft.com/kb/930045

Eine Möglichkeit, dies zu testen, besteht darin, eine geplante Aufgabe zu erstellen, um den Server in (z. B.) 5 Minuten neu zu starten und sich dann abzumelden. Auf diese Weise ist beim Neustart keine Terminaldienstsitzung aktiv. Wenn der Neustart jetzt normal funktioniert, kann das oben genannte durchaus der Grund sein.

Antwort2

Einer der im Juni veröffentlichten Patches hat dieses Problem auf vielen unserer Server verursacht, insbesondere bei SQL- und Citrix-Clustern (ca. 30/500+).

Haben Sie einen Neustart über die Eingabeaufforderung versucht?

shutdown -f -r -t 10

BEARBEITEN:

Können Sie Ihre Frage außerdem bearbeiten und die letzten Abschnitte des Herunterfahrprotokolls einfügen?

\WINDOWS\system32\LogFiles\Shutdown

Antwort3

Sie können IIS und SQL Server sowie Ihre Apps vor dem Neustart stoppen. Wenn Sie dadurch einen sauberen Neustart erhalten, wissen Sie, dass es sich um eines davon handelt, und das Herausfinden eines davon ist ein Ausschlussverfahren.

Ich würde versuchen zu überprüfen, ob sie nur lokal RDP ausprobieren oder ob sie es tatsächlich mit KVM oder einer lokalen Tastatur/Maus/einem lokalen Monitor versuchen. Wenn sie nur RDP ausprobieren, ist es überhaupt kein Wunder, dass sie nicht weiterkommen als Sie.

Antwort4

Fügen Sie VNC oder Logmein hinzu, da Sie damit Konsolenzugriff erhalten (fügen Sie beides hinzu, warum nicht), und Sie werden möglicherweise sehen, was passiert.

Schauen Sie sich auch anWizmovon GRC ist ein kleines Allzweck-Dienstprogramm, das einen Shutdown/Neustart über die Befehlszeile durchführen kann. Auf problematischen Rechnern funktioniert es meiner Erfahrung nach besser als der Windows-Befehl zum Herunterfahren.

verwandte Informationen